SATCO|NUVO’s STARFISH Smart Outdoor Pan & Tilt Camera

December 1, 2025

Easily expand home security with SATCO|NUVO’s Smart Wireless Outdoor Pan and Tilt Camera with Solar Panel. Easily mount to siding or eaves to view any outdoor space. Use the app to adjust the viewing angle panning 355° and tilting up to 70°. View real-time or review motion activated events from anywhere on your mobile device with the STARFISH® app. Discreetly listen in or actively engage in conversation with the two-way talk feature. Best of all, no subscription fees, ever. This camera is also compatible with Google Home, Siri, SmartThings, and Alexa.

Features

  • Simple Wireless Installation
  • Rechargeable Battery or Pair with Solar Panel For Continuous Charging
  • 5MP Camera
  • Adjust Camera Position & Viewing Angle Via App
  • Remote Viewing & Two-Way Talk
  • Live & Event History Monitoring
  • Expandable Micro SD Card Storage
